Catholic Exchange has reviewed Thomas Cromwell: The rise and fall of Henry VIII’s most notorious minister and House of Treason: The Rise and Fall of a Tudor Dynasty. Both are by Robert Hutchinson. I haven’t read the one on Cromwell but have thumbed through The House of Treason, a book covering the Howards more than the Tudors. The review gives some good information on each. These are two Tudor books you don’t hear a lot about, so the review is worth checking out!
